What does INDB0VCUB10 mean?
INDB0VCUB10
INDB — Bank code. Identifies Indusind Bank. All branches of Indusind Bank share this prefix.
0 — Reserved character. Always zero in every IFSC code in India.
VCUB10 — Branch code. Uniquely identifies the BHIMAVARAM branch within Indusind Bank.
